Understanding the Fahrenheit and Celsius Scales



Before diving into the conversion, let's grasp the fundamental differences between these two scales. The Fahrenheit scale, developed by Daniel Gabriel Fahrenheit, defines the freezing point of water as 32°F and the boiling point as 212°F. Celsius, or Centigrade, developed by Anders Celsius, sets the freezing point of water at 0°C and the boiling point at 100°C. This difference in defining points leads to the need for conversion formulas when dealing with temperatures in both scales.


The Conversion Formula: From Fahrenheit to Celsius



The formula for converting Fahrenheit (°F) to Celsius (°C) is:

°C = (°F - 32) × 5/9

This formula essentially accounts for the different starting points and the different scales between the freezing and boiling points of water. Let's break it down:

1. Subtract 32: We first subtract 32 from the Fahrenheit temperature. This aligns the starting point of both scales (freezing point of water).
2. Multiply by 5/9: We then multiply the result by 5/9. This adjusts for the different size of the degree increments between the freezing and boiling points of water on the two scales.


Converting 119°F to °C: A Step-by-Step Example



Let's apply the formula to convert 119°F to °C:

1. Subtract 32: 119°F - 32 = 87
2. Multiply by 5/9: 87 × 5/9 = 48.33

Therefore, 119°F is equal to approximately 48.33°C.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)



1. Can I convert Celsius to Fahrenheit? Yes, the reverse formula is °F = (°C × 9/5) + 32.

2. Why is the conversion factor 5/9? It reflects the ratio of the degree intervals between the freezing and boiling points of water on the Celsius and Fahrenheit scales.

3. Is it necessary to be precise to several decimal places? While the formula provides a precise answer, rounding to one or two decimal places is often sufficient for most practical purposes.
